/* SPDX-License-Identifier: GPL-2.0 */
/* Copyright (C) 2019 Arm Ltd.
*
* Based on msm_gem_freedreno.c:
* Copyright (C) 2016 Red Hat
* Author: Rob Clark <robdclark@gmail.com>
*/
#include <linux/list.h>
#include <drm/drm_device.h>
#include <drm/drm_gem_shmem_helper.h>
#include "panfrost_device.h"
#include "panfrost_gem.h"
#include "panfrost_mmu.h"
static unsigned long
panfrost_gem_shrinker_count(struct shrinker *shrinker, struct shrink_control *sc)
{
<------>struct panfrost_device *pfdev =
<------><------>container_of(shrinker, struct panfrost_device, shrinker);
<------>struct drm_gem_shmem_object *shmem;
<------>unsigned long count = 0;
<------>if (!mutex_trylock(&pfdev->shrinker_lock))
<------><------>return 0;
<------>list_for_each_entry(shmem, &pfdev->shrinker_list, madv_list) {
<------><------>if (drm_gem_shmem_is_purgeable(shmem))
<------><------><------>count += shmem->base.size >> PAGE_SHIFT;
<------>}
<------>mutex_unlock(&pfdev->shrinker_lock);
<------>return count;
}
static bool panfrost_gem_purge(struct drm_gem_object *obj)
{
<------>struct drm_gem_shmem_object *shmem = to_drm_gem_shmem_obj(obj);
<------>struct panfrost_gem_object *bo = to_panfrost_bo(obj);
<------>bool ret = false;
<------>if (atomic_read(&bo->gpu_usecount))
<------><------>return false;
<------>if (!mutex_trylock(&bo->mappings.lock))
<------><------>return false;
<------>if (!mutex_trylock(&shmem->pages_lock))
<------><------>goto unlock_mappings;
<------>panfrost_gem_teardown_mappings_locked(bo);
<------>drm_gem_shmem_purge_locked(obj);
<------>ret = true;
<------>mutex_unlock(&shmem->pages_lock);
unlock_mappings:
<------>mutex_unlock(&bo->mappings.lock);
<------>return ret;
}
static unsigned long
panfrost_gem_shrinker_scan(struct shrinker *shrinker, struct shrink_control *sc)
{
<------>struct panfrost_device *pfdev =
<------><------>container_of(shrinker, struct panfrost_device, shrinker);
<------>struct drm_gem_shmem_object *shmem, *tmp;
<------>unsigned long freed = 0;
<------>if (!mutex_trylock(&pfdev->shrinker_lock))
<------><------>return SHRINK_STOP;
<------>list_for_each_entry_safe(shmem, tmp, &pfdev->shrinker_list, madv_list) {
<------><------>if (freed >= sc->nr_to_scan)
<------><------><------>break;
<------><------>if (drm_gem_shmem_is_purgeable(shmem) &&
<------><------> panfrost_gem_purge(&shmem->base)) {
<------><------><------>freed += shmem->base.size >> PAGE_SHIFT;
<------><------><------>list_del_init(&shmem->madv_list);
<------><------>}
<------>}
<------>mutex_unlock(&pfdev->shrinker_lock);
<------>if (freed > 0)
<------><------>pr_info_ratelimited("Purging %lu bytes\n", freed << PAGE_SHIFT);
<------>return freed;
}
/**
* panfrost_gem_shrinker_init - Initialize panfrost shrinker
* @dev: DRM device
*
* This function registers and sets up the panfrost shrinker.
*/
void panfrost_gem_shrinker_init(struct drm_device *dev)
{
<------>struct panfrost_device *pfdev = dev->dev_private;
<------>pfdev->shrinker.count_objects = panfrost_gem_shrinker_count;
<------>pfdev->shrinker.scan_objects = panfrost_gem_shrinker_scan;
<------>pfdev->shrinker.seeks = DEFAULT_SEEKS;
<------>WARN_ON(register_shrinker(&pfdev->shrinker));
}
/**
* panfrost_gem_shrinker_cleanup - Clean up panfrost shrinker
* @dev: DRM device
*
* This function unregisters the panfrost shrinker.
*/
void panfrost_gem_shrinker_cleanup(struct drm_device *dev)
{
<------>struct panfrost_device *pfdev = dev->dev_private;
<------>if (pfdev->shrinker.nr_deferred) {
<------><------>unregister_shrinker(&pfdev->shrinker);
<------>}
}
